The $40 million Melania Trump movie made just £33,000 at the UK box office in its opening weekend, almost failing to hit the Top 30.

Despite sitting at just 5% positive reviews on Rotten Tomatoes, Donald Trump fans have hit the fan on Popcornmeter, bringing it up to 99% audience approval for the controversial new documentary film.

Although the movie is focused on the First Lady, President Trump does feature throughout in the couple’s 20 day run up to their 2nd inauguration last year.

But for those who have seen the film, did you spot the blink-and-you’ll-miss-it moment that hints at Trump’s third term intentions?

The 47th president has Trump 2028 hats on sale and hasn’t exactly shut down calls for him to run for an unconstitutional third term. But if the ending of the Melania movie is anything to go by, the Trumps will be leaving the White House once again in January 2029. The evidence for this is found alongside the official 2nd-term photo portrait of the First Lady, displayed just before the end credits.

Underneath the photograph, it says “First Lady 2017-2021 and 2025-2029”. Of course, it’s unusual to set an end date three years out, as the president (and thus his First Lady) may leave office mid-term, either willingly or unwillingly, via resignation, impeachment, or death. This aside, Melania, who had editorial control over this documentary, approved 2029 as the day she would stop being First Lady. If that’s anything to go by, it suggests the Trumps truly do intend to leave office after two terms and make way for another Republican candidate for 2028, like Vice President JD Vance.
